Transaction d90208705178e3478c70d5b72ed8bc9f4b226962747bf49f84eddcbb97dfdeea
1 Input
1 Output
-
d90208705178e3478c70d5b72ed8bc9f4b226962747bf49f84eddcbb97dfdeea:0
- value
- 63979
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 68e628be893f7106389b7b8b01a3fabe8e3471d77f93977a96bb81c414ded0be
- address
- bc1pdrnz305f8acsvwym0w9srgl6h68rguwh07few75khwqug9x76zlqklpuev